-
Total de ítens
4.020 -
Registro em
-
Última visita
-
Days Won
71
Tipo de Conteúdo
Blocks
Notes ACBrLibNFe
Fóruns
Downloads
Calendário
Tudo que Renato Rubinho postou
-
Refatoração do Programa de exemplo ConsultaCEP em PHP
um tópico no fórum postou Renato Rubinho Notícias do ACBr
Olá pessoal, O programa de exemplo da ConsultaCEP em PHP foi refatorado (Rev-36953), seguindo os padrões que foram adotados nos novos programas que estão sendo desenvolvidos: Incorporado ACBrComum.php que contém métodos gerais que podem ser utilizados por todas as bibliotecas, removendo a redundância dos métodos Removidos arquivos individuais por método e centralizadas chamadas no ACBrCEPServicos**.php (** = MT ou ST) Unificada página principal em ACBrConsultaCNPJBase.php centralizando o código e removendo redundância entre MT e ST ..\ACBr\Projetos\ACBrLib\Demos\PHP\ConsultaCEP\ACBrCEPDemoST.php ..\ACBr\Projetos\ACBrLib\Demos\PHP\ConsultaCEP\ACBrCEPDemoMT.php Até mais!!! -
Refatoração do Programa de exemplo ConsultaCNPJ em PHP
um tópico no fórum postou Renato Rubinho Notícias do ACBr
Olá pessoal, O programa de exemplo da ConsultaCNPJ em PHP foi refatorado (Rev-36889), seguindo os padrões que foram adotados nos novos programas que estão sendo desenvolvidos: Incorporado ACBrComum.php que contém métodos gerais que podem ser utilizados por todas as bibliotecas, removendo a redundância dos métodos Removidos arquivos individuais por método e centralizadas chamadas no ACBrConsultaCNPJServicos**.php (** = MT ou ST) Unificada página principal em ACBrConsultaCNPJBase.php centralizando o código e removendo redundância entre MT e ST ..\ACBr\Projetos\ACBrLib\Demos\PHP\ConsultaCNPJ\ACBrConsultaCNPJDemoST.php ..\ACBr\Projetos\ACBrLib\Demos\PHP\ConsultaCNPJ\ACBrConsultaCNPJDemoMT.php Até mais!!! -
Olá pessoal, Foi enviado ao SVN na Rev-36697 a alteração da classe TinfoIRComplem do S-5002, que passou a ser uma TCollection devido a mudança do leiaute 1.3. Até a versão anterior, o número máximo de ocorrências era 1 e passou a ser 13, conforme destacado abaixo. Segue exemplo de mudança de tratamento a ser feita, caso sua aplicação esteja considerando o retorno desta classe: De: var dtLaudo: TDateTime; begin dtLaudo := IdeTrabalhador.infoIRComplem.dtLaudo; . . . Para: var i: Integer; dtLaudo: TDateTime; begin for i:=0 to IdeTrabalhador.infoIRComplem.Count - 1 do begin dtLaudo := IdeTrabalhador.infoIRComplem.Items[i].dtLaudo; . . . end; . . . Até mais!!!
-
Implementação de boleto com PHP / ScriptCase
Renato Rubinho replied to Ricardo Silva_21978's tópico in ACBrBoleto
Desenvolvemos programas de exemplo em PHP sem framework e a comunicação com as bibliotecas via FFI. Lembrando que o FFI foi disponibilizado a partir da versão 7.4 do PHP, verifique se sua versão do ScriptCase é compatível. Se você consegue consumir outras bibliotecas com o ScriptCase, utilizando FFI, provavelmente irá funcionar com as bibliotecas do ACBr também. -
Fechando. Para novas dúvidas, criar um novo tópico.
-
Fechando. Para novas dúvidas, criar um novo tópico.
-
-
Publicada versão 3.1.8 do Guia Prático da EFD ICMS IPI
Renato Rubinho replied to Diego Foliene's tópico in Notícias do ACBr
Olá, Foi revisada a versão 3.1.8 do leiaute do EFD-ICMS/IPI e não foram necessárias alterações no componente, conforme itens a seguir. 1. Alteração da validação dos campos 14 e 18 do registro D100 1.1. Campo 14 (CHV_CTE_REF) * Nova Validação....: Quando o campo 13 (TP_CT-e) for igual a “3 ou 6”, informar a chave do documento substituído. Nas demais situações o campo não deve ser preenchido. * Validação Anterior: Quando o campo 13 (TP_CT-e) for igual a “3 ou 5”, informar a chave do documento substituído. Nas demais situações o campo não deve ser preenchido. 1.2. Campo 18 (VL_SERV) * Nova Validação.....: Se CT-e simplificado (COD_MOD 57 e TP_CT-e 5 ou 6) e IND_OPER = 1, o valor deve ser igual à soma do campo VL_FRT do(s) registro(s) D130 existentes. * Validação Anterior : Se CT-e simplificado (COD_MOD 57 e TP_CT-e 4 ou 5), o valor deve ser igual à soma do campo VL_FRT do(s) registro(s) D130 existentes. 2. Alteração da descrição do registro D130 * Nova Validação.....: Este registro tem por objetivo informar o complemento do Conhecimento de Transporte Rodoviário de Cargas (Código 08), Conhecimento de Transporte de Cargas Avulso (Código 8B) e, a partir de janeiro de 2025, o Conhecimento de Transporte Eletrônico Simplificado (Código 57, TP_CT-e 5 e 6). * Validação Anterior : Este registro tem por objetivo informar o complemento do Conhecimento de Transporte Rodoviário de Cargas (Código 08), Conhecimento de Transporte de Cargas Avulso (Código 8B) e, a partir de janeiro de 2025, o Conhecimento de Transporte Eletrônico Simplificado (Código 57, TP_CTe 4 e 5). 3. Alteração na exceção nº 4 do registro D100 * Nova Informação....: A partir de janeiro/2025, para o CT-e Simplificado-modelo 57, conforme estabelecido pelo Ajuste Sinief nº 46/2023, deverão ser informados os respectivos Registros D130 na escrituração das prestações de saída. * Informação Anterior: A partir de janeiro/2025, para o CT-e Simplificado-modelo 57, conforme estabelecido pelo Ajuste Sinief nº 46/2023, deverão ser informados os respectivos Registros D130. Até mais!!! -
Obrigado pela contribuição. Foram enviadas correções ao SVN que devem resolver o problema relatado, Rev-36378 Por favor atualize os fontes, reinstale os componentes, verifique se o problema foi resolvido e, se possível, nos informe se foi o resultado esperado.
-
Olá, O componente ACBrSPEDPisCofins foi compatibilizado com a Nota Técnica nº009/2024 e as alterações foram enviados na Rev-36309 conforme os itens a seguir. 1. A partir dos fatos geradores ocorridos em 01 de janeiro de 2025, não será mais possível escriturar o “Registro 0145: Regime de Apuração da Contribuição Previdenciária Sobre a Receita Bruta” e, consequentemente, nenhum registro do bloco P, no PGE da EFD Contribuições. * Revisados registros 0145 e P001 (por consequência seus registros inferiores) para que não sejam gerados a partir de 01/01/2025 2. A consequente necessidade de ajuste do leiaute dos registros do bloco D no PGE da EFD Contribuições para recepcionar este novo modelo de documento. Para tanto, a contar dos fatos geradores ocorridos a partir de 01/04/2025, ficarão alterados os registros abaixo mencionados 2.1. Registro D500 * Novo campo CHV_DOC_E: Existente a partir de 01/04/2025 2.2. Registros D501, D505, D509, D600, D601, D605 * Os registros foram destacados, mas não constam informações a respeito de mudanças além do destaque nas suas descrições, adicionando a referência aos documentos adicionados a seguir * Nota Fiscal Fatura de Serviços de Comunicação Eletrônica (Código 62) * NF-e (Código 55) – Documentos de Aquisição com Direito a Crédito Até mais!!!
- 1 reply
-
- 2
-
-
- efd
- efdcontrib
- (e 3 mais)
-
Obrigado pela contribuição. Criada TK-6294 para análise.
-
Enviado ao SVN ajuste no critério de preenchimento do campo.
-
Obrigado pela contribuição. Criada TK-6287 para análise e enviadas correções ao SVN que devem resolver o problema relatado, Rev-36292 Fiz um ajuste para considerar as versões posteriores além da atual, e para manter em ambos os casos o número de ocorrências como zero (permite que a tag não seja gerada quando não for informada), pois a cardinalidade é de 0-1 em ambas as versões, conforme pode ser visto nos seus prints. Por favor atualize os fontes, reinstale os componentes, verifique se o problema foi resolvido e, se possível, nos informe se foi o resultado esperado.
-
Problema de Assinatura GISS - Santos SP
Renato Rubinho replied to Cauê Lazzaroti's tópico in ACBrNFSe
-
Publicada versão 3.1.7 do Guia Prático da EFD ICMS IPI
Renato Rubinho replied to Diego Foliene's tópico in Notícias do ACBr
Olá, O componente ACBrSPEDFiscal foi compatibilizado com a versão 3.1.7 do leiaute do EFD-ICMS/IPI e as alterações foram enviados na Rev-36270 conforme os itens a seguir. 1. Alteração da validação do registro C700 * Havia a exceção para o código 66 que foi removida. * Essa alteração não requer alteração no componente. 2. Alteração da obrigatoriedade dos campos 23 e 24 do registro D700 * Os campos passaram de "OC"(Deve ser preenchido quando houver valor) para "O"(Sempre preenchido) * Serão preenchidos zeros a partir de 2025 quando não for informado valor 3. Criação do campo 32 no registro D700 * Novo campo adicionado na classe. 4. Alteração da validação do campo 11 do registro D700 * Validação anterior corresponde à soma dos campos VL_SERV, VL_SERV_NT e VL_TERC subtraído das deduções da NFCom. * A partir de 2025: Corresponde à soma dos campos VL_SERV, VL_SERV_NT e VL_TERC subtraído do campo DED * Essa alteração não requer alteração no componente. 5. Criação do campo 17 no registro D750 * Novo campo adicionado na classe. 6. Alteração da obrigatoriedade dos campos 15 e 16 do registro D750 * Os campos passaram de "O"(Sempre preenchido) para "OC"(Deve ser preenchido quando houver valor) * Ficarão nulos a partir de 2025 quando não for informado valor 7. Alteração da validação do campo 07 do registro D750 * Validação anterior: Corresponde à soma dos campos VL_SERV, VL_SERV_NT e VL_TERC subtraído das deduções da NFCom. * A partir de 2025: Corresponde à soma dos campos VL_SERV, VL_SERV_NT e VL_TERC subtraído do campo DED * Essa alteração não requer alteração no componente. 8. Alteração da validação do campo 02 do registro E113. * Validação: * quando o modelo de documento for igual a 59 (CF-e SAT), 63 (BP-e) ou 65 (NFC-e), deve ser apresentado conteúdo VAZIO “||”. * Quando o modelo de documento for igual a 06 (NF/CEE) ou 66 (NF3e), o seu preenchimento é facultativo. * Campo de preenchimento obrigatório para os demais modelos de documento * O valor informado deve existir no campo COD_PART do registro 0150. * Essa alteração não requer alteração no componente. 9. Alterações de preenchimento dos campos 14, 24 e 25 do registro D100 9.1. Campo 14 * Informação do Manual: * Quando o campo 13 (TP_CT-e) for igual a “3 ou 5”, informar a chave do documento substituído. * Nas demais situações o campo não deve ser preenchido * Essa alteração não requer alteração no componente. 9.2. Campo 24 * Nova Informação do Manual: * preencher com o código do município de **ORIGEM** do serviço, conforme a tabela IBGE. * Preencher com 9999999, se Exterior. * Preencher com “9999998” quando se tratar de CT-e simplificado ou substituição de CT-e simplificado. * Essa alteração não requer alteração no componente. 9.3. Campo 25 * Nova Informação do Manual: * preencher com o código do município de **DESTINO** do serviço, conforme a tabela IBGE. * Preencher com 9999999, se Exterior. * Preencher com “9999998” quando se tratar de CT-e simplificado ou substituição de CT-e simplificado. * Essa alteração não requer alteração no componente. 10. Inclusão do Conhecimento de transporte eletrônico simplificado no registro D130 * Nova Informação do Manual: * Este registro tem por objetivo informar a partir de janeiro de 2025, o Conhecimento de Transporte Eletrônico Simplificado (Código 57, TP_CTe 4 e 5). * Em relação ao Conhecimento de Transporte Eletrônico Simplificado, este registro tem por objetivo identificar individualmente cada entrega/prestação abrangida neste documento * Essa alteração não requer alteração no componente. 11. Alteração no preenchimento dos campos 02, 03, 05 e 06 do registro D130 11.1. Campo 02 * Nova Informação do Manual em negrito: preencher com a informação constante no corpo do Conhecimento de Transporte Rodoviário de Cargas (CTRC) no campo consignatário ou no campo tomador do CT-e simplificado. * Essa alteração não requer alteração no componente. 11.2. Campo 03 * Nova Informação do Manual em negrito: preencher com a informação constante no corpo do CTRC ou do CT-e simplificado no campo redespacho. * Essa alteração não requer alteração no componente. 11.3. Campo 05 * Nova Informação do Manual: Caso trate de item de CT-e simplificado, preencher com o município de origem da prestação a que se refere este item. * Essa alteração não requer alteração no componente. 11.4. Campo 06 * Nova Informação do Manual: Caso trate de item de CT-e simplificado, preencher com o município de destino da prestação a que se refere este item * Essa alteração não requer alteração no componente. 12. Alteração na regra de validação do campo 18 do registro D100. * Nova Informação do Manual: Se CT-e simplificado (COD_MOD 57 e TP_CTe 4 ou 5), o valor deve ser igual à soma do campo VL_FRT do(s) registro(s) D130 existentes * Essa alteração não requer alteração no componente. 13. Alteração da exceção 4 do registro D100. * Nova Informação do Manual: A partir de janeiro/2025, para o CT-e Simplificado-modelo 57, conforme estabelecido pelo Ajuste Sinief nº 46/2023, deverão ser informados os respectivos Registros D130. * Essa alteração não requer alteração no componente. Até mais!!! -
NFSE de Jundiaí/SP está mudando o webservices
Renato Rubinho replied to Atalias's tópico in ACBrNFSe
-
NFSE de Jundiaí/SP está mudando o webservices
Renato Rubinho replied to Atalias's tópico in ACBrNFSe
Seu envio ainda foi com apenas uma assinatura. Houveram mudanças no componente para resolver isso. Atualize os fontes, faça o revert caso tenha alterações locais, reinstale os componentes e teste novamente. -
De acordo com a tabela, o "valor 32" é IRRF sobre 13°, seria o ciiValorIRRF13oSalario. O desconto simplificado mensal é 68 mesmo, como consta na tabela. Segue documento com a tabela para análise. https://svn.code.sf.net/p/acbr/code/tools/DFe/eSOCIAL/S-1.3__2024_12/Leiautes do eSocial v. S-1.3 - Anexo I - Tabelas (cons. até NT 02.2024 rev.).pdf